2,147,555,142 is a composite number, even.
2,147,555,142 (two billion one hundred forty-seven million five hundred fifty-five thousand one hundred forty-two) is an even 10-digit number. It is a composite number with 96 divisors, and factors as 2 × 3² × 19 × 61 × 311 × 331. Its proper divisors sum to 2,861,767,098,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x80011746.
